要说NetBeans与eclipse谁好用,其实各有各的好,我当然是各取所长了,我一般是结合使用,前期我使用eclipse+myeclipse插件,很容易实现在项目中加入一些框架并生成配置文件,比如Spring,Hibernate,Struts等框架,当然在netbeans中也可以一步实现在项目里加入Struts及其他一些框架,但是netbeans加入Spring,Hibernate就没那么方便了,必须要自己手动配置以及编写配置文件。所以我一般是先用eclipse+myeclipse做一个前期配置。然后再用netbeans做后期的编码工作,其中值得一提的就是从eclipse工程到netbeans的转化,需要更新一下netbens的插件,以netbeans5.5为例,点击工具(Tools)->更新中心(Update Center)->下一步(Next)然后在列出的可用更新模块中选择Eclipse Project Importer 然后添加(Add)之后安装就可以了。
安装好后 在netbeans中选择文件->导入工程->Eclipse Project 就可以了,这样Eclipse Project 就变成了netbeans的工程了。
我在后期编码的时候要选择netbeans,是因为netbeans提供了超级强大的编码机制,写代码特别快,下面说的很是很多人netbenas特别地方,这也是我喜欢它的原因,在netbeans中 举个例子来说:你如果输入psvm然后输入空格会自动生成如下代码
public static void main(String[] args) {
}
类似的机制有很多,你也可以自定义一些简写模板,你如想要知道其他的话可以通过工具—>选项->编辑器->代码模板来查看。不过我有一点要说明的是在输入psvm+空格的时候必须一次性输对,意思就是说在输入psvm的时候不能按删除键,不然是看不到效果的。
还有一点就是你比如你在程序里写了一个变量名叫jasyptstudy,这时你输入j然后按ctrl+K时就会自动补齐到jasyptstudy,如果你没有补齐到jasyptstudy,而是到以j开头的其他字符,你可以多按几次ctrl+K一直到满意为止。这样一来的话编码就变得很快很快了,非常有效的减少了敲击键盘的次数。